The Mist Trail splits off from the John Muir Trail (JMT) and takes you past some of the finest waterfall scenery in Yosemite, taking in Vernal Fall from up close and misty (prepare to get wet in the spring and early summer), past Emerald Pool, up by Nevada Fall and rejoins the JMT at a pleasant open area with sunny slabs for lunching on. The Mist Trail begins at Happy Isles which is right on the Merced River. Due to the popularity of this trail, most visitors either take the shuttle to this stop (#16) or park at Curry Village and walk an extra 1.5 miles round trip.The Mist Trail begins just a short distance from the Happy Isles Bridge in Yosemite Valley. The closest parking lot is the Yosemite Valley Trailhead Parking, located between the trailhead and Half Dome Village.
